I’m a fashion designer and wrote my thesis on West African Textiles.
There’s a L O T to unpack so here’s a checklist

*Traditional Ashanti Kingdom (Ghana, Ivory Coast)textiles:
handwoven: Kente cloth,
stamped: Adinkra cloth,
hand painted:Korhogo Cloth,

*Traditional Malian textiles:
Resist dyed fabric through mud fermentation +natural dyes: Mudcloth or Bogolan

*Traditional Kuba Kingdom Textiles:
Kuba Cloth or Raffia Cloth, handwoven palm strands with beadwork/cowry shells.

*Traditional Buganda Kingdom (modern day Uganda).
Bark cloth. As ancient as the 12th century. Unesco world heritage.
